DETECTIVES were investigating today after a man was brutally attacked in Glasgow.
The 25-year-old suffered serious injuries in the attack, which police are treating as attempted murder.
The alarm was raised about 5.10am yesterday when officers were initially called to a report of a incident in Old Rutherglen Road, Gorbals.
When they attended, they found the injured man in the road.
He was taken to the Victoria Infirmary, where hospital staff today described his condition as "serious but stable".
It is understood detectives have yet to speak at length to the victim, who is still seriously ill in hospital.
Officers are reviewing CCTV footage and carrying out door-to-door inquiries in an
attempt to find out more about the attack.
A section of road at Old Rutherglen Road and McNeil Street
remained cordoned off yesterday.
Detectives are appealing for anyone with
information to contact them to help catch the attacker.
Witnesses and
those who have information about the
incident were today being urged to contact police.
A police spokeswoman said: "Officers were called to an
incident in Old Rutherglen Road at about 5.10am on Boxing
Day.
"A 25-year-old man was found seriously
injured. Officers are treating the incident as attempted murder."
